Adrien de Bassompierre

Senior Carbon Finance Specialist, World Bank

Adrien de Bassompierre is a Senior Carbon Finance Specialist at the Climate Policy and Finance Department of the World Bank. He is a member of the Secretariat of the Partnership for Market Readiness (PMR), a grant-based, global partnership of developed and developing countries that provides funding and technical assistance for the collective innovation and piloting of market-based instruments for GHG emissions reduction. In addition, Adrien manages a portfolio of over 10 CDM projects and programs in the Middle East and Africa. Adrien has been with the Carbon Finance Unit of the World Bank since 2007, and working on climate change for more than 12 years. Prior to joining the World Bank Group, Adrien was in the private sector, working as a project manager and an advisor for European environmental affairs, including on the EU emissions trading system.

Adrien received a B.Sc. in Business Administration and Economics and an M.A. in Economics from the University of Namur, Belgium, and an M.A. in International Energy and Environmental Policy from the Johns Hopkins University.
